Cost considerations and budgeting tips

Budgeting is a cornerstone of any expansion plan. When evaluating a core and shell house extension dublin, account for site access, foundation work, and the shell’s weatherproofing before interior fit-out. Contingency planning—typically 10–15 percent of the project—addresses unexpected issues such as soil conditions or supply delays. For house extensions dublin, compare quotes from multiple firms and request itemized estimates that separate structural work from interior finishes. A clear financial plan prevents surprises and supports timely completion.
